British Prime Minister Keir Starmer is considering the “political realities” facing his government, a senior minister says, as speculation increases that he could resign within days. Multiple outlets report that the comments come amid mounting pressure and heightened media attention on Starmer’s future. The minister, speaking without ruling out resignation, frames upcoming decisions as influenced by political circumstances rather than providing a clear statement of intent. One report describes a broader pattern of instability around the government, including references to policy reversals, scandals, and the resignation of other ministers. Taken together, the articles present an evolving political situation in which Starmer appears to be reassessing key decisions and his capacity to continue leading. While the reports do not confirm any timetable or final outcome, they indicate that public calls for Starmer to step down are increasing and that he is actively weighing his next move. The reports emphasize that the latest remarks are suggestive rather than conclusive, and that the situation remains in flux.
